Experience We are specialists in air discharge testing from stacks and vents for particulate matter, reduced sulphur compounds, sulphur dioxide, metals (including mercury), HF, formaldehyde, HCl, VOC's, odour, dioxin and PAH's. We have conducted air emission testing for many different manufacturing and chemical processes in New Zealand. These include:
Pulp and Paper Manufacturing and By-Products Processing – reduced sulphur compounds including hydrogen sulphide, methyl mercaptan, dimethyl sulphide and dimethyl disulphide, sulphur dioxide, particulate matter, HCl, hydrogen peroxide, methanol, odour and volatile wood compounds such as alpha and beta pinene
Timber Processing and Wood Fired Boilers – dust and particulate matter, PCDDs and PCDFs, PAHs, formaldehyde and related compounds, volatile wood compounds
Chemical Manufacture and Formulation - Volatile organic compounds, reduced sulphur compounds, oxides of sulphur and particulate matter
Coal Fired Power Generation – sulphur dioxide and sulphuric acid mist, trace metals including mercury, HF, HCl and chlorine, PCDDs and PCDFs, oxides of nitrogen including nitrous oxide, particulate matter
Geothermal Power Generation - mercury
Printing and Laminating Plants – solvent species such as benzene, xylene, toluene, ethanol and isopropanol, formaldehyde and related species, odour.
Solvent Recovery – solvent species such as perchloroethylene, benzene, toluene and xylene.
Oil and Gas Recovery (Flare Pits) - particulate matter, sulphur dioxide and sulphuric acid mist, PCDDs, PCDFs and PAHs
Sewage Treatment Plants – Total reduced sulphur
Aluminium Extrusion – particulate matter and sodium hydroxide mist
Isokinetic Stack Testing Where an industrial air emission involves particles or droplets, stack testing methods require isokinetic sampling. This technique ensures that an even distribution of particles is collected and there is no discrimination for small or large particles. During isokinetic sampling the stack tester adjusts the flow through the sampling train such that the velocity at the train’s nozzle tip matches the velocity of the stack gas at the measuring point.
